Manipur bans two cough syrup brands after toxic chemical found; public urged to avoid use

The Manipur government has issued an immediate ban on two cough syrup brands — Relife and Resipfresh TR — after laboratory tests confirmed the presence of diethylene glycol, a highly toxic industrial chemical that poses serious health risks if consumed.
